Output 5debaa103ddd81cfbfa7a522f96d0385d63b082eb589db74bfb561fbb7c648da:2

value
6424181800
script pubkey
OP_0 OP_PUSHBYTES_20 f4b5b81f9c99a813da66ff939dc261930548c7af
address
tb1q7j6ms8uunx5p8knxl7femsnpjvz533a08vr36x
transaction
5debaa103ddd81cfbfa7a522f96d0385d63b082eb589db74bfb561fbb7c648da
spent
true